The 25,000 SF Irvine High School Performing Arts Complex project consisted of ground-up construction for a single-story, state-of-the-art facility. Phase one included the demolition of existing structures, site utility relocations, grading, and deep soil mixing columns/ground improvements. Phase two involved building construction, site paving, concrete flatwork, utility systems, and landscape planting/irrigation.
The steel and metal frame diaphragm building featured a combination of metal panels, plaster, and a curtain wall system as exterior finishes. The interior included a 650-seat main theater space with a full production stage that incorporated state-of-the-art sound, lighting, and rigging systems. The Performing Arts Complex (PAC) also featured a Black Box theater, Scene Shop, Dressing Rooms, and lobby space.
